Title: Innovator Jin Ho Seo: A Pioneer in Image Sensor Technology
Introduction
Jin Ho Seo, based in Seoul, South Korea, has made significant contributions to the field of image sensor technology with an impressive portfolio of 40 patents. His innovative approach and dedication to advancing imaging technology have positioned him as a leading inventor in the electronics industry.
Latest Patents
Seo's recent patents focus on advanced image sensors. One notable patent involves a design for an image sensor that includes a first photodiode and a first circuit with an overflow transistor and a first transfer transistor connected to the photodiode. This innovative design incorporates a switch element and a capacitor situated between the first transfer transistor and the switch element, where the capacitor is a physical component. Additionally, his design features a second photodiode and a second circuit, which includes a second transfer transistor connected to the photodiode and a reset transistor linked to the output of the first circuit. This sophisticated combination enhances the functionality and efficiency of image sensors in various applications.
